Eastern Amberwing vs Himalayan Rat
Perithemis tenera compared with Rattus pyctoris
Taxonomic Classification
| Rank | Eastern Amberwing | Himalayan Rat |
|---|---|---|
| Kingdom same | Animalia (Animals) | Animalia (Animals) |
| Phylum | Arthropoda (artrópode) | Chordata (cordados) |
| Class | Insecta (inseto) | Mammalia (mamíferos) |
| Order | Odonata (Odonata) | Rodentia (Roedores) |
| Family | Libellulidae | Muridae (Mice & Rats) |
| Genus | Perithemis | Rattus |
| Species | Perithemis tenera | Rattus pyctoris |
Evolutionary Relationship
Eastern Amberwing and Himalayan Rat share a common ancestor at the Kingdom level: Animalia. (Animals)
